What Is Childhood Leukemia?
Leukemia is a cancer of the blood and bone marrow, where abnormal white blood cells multiply uncontrollably and interfere with the production of healthy blood cells.
The two most common types in children are:
- Acute Lymphoblastic Leukemia (ALL) – the most common childhood leukemia
- Acute Myeloid Leukemia (AML) – less common but often requires intensive treatment
With advances in pediatric oncology, cure rates for many forms of childhood leukemia are very high when treatment is started promptly and managed by an experienced Pediatric Leukemia Specialist in India.
Common Symptoms of Leukemia in Children
Symptoms can resemble common childhood illnesses, which is why specialist evaluation is important.
Warning Signs Include:
- Frequent fever or infections
- Unusual tiredness and weakness
- Pale skin
- Easy bruising or bleeding
- Bone or joint pain
- Swollen lymph nodes
- Enlarged abdomen
- Poor appetite
- Unexplained weight loss
If your child experiences these symptoms, timely consultation with a pediatric hematologist-oncologist is essential.

Childhood Leukemia Treatment in India
Treatment depends on the type of leukemia, genetic risk factors, and the child’s response to therapy.
1. Chemotherapy
The mainstay of treatment, chemotherapy is given in carefully planned phases to eliminate leukemia cells and prevent recurrence.
2. Targeted Therapy
Certain leukemia subtypes respond to medications that attack specific genetic abnormalities.
3. Immunotherapy
Advanced treatments help the child’s immune system recognize and destroy cancer cells.
4. Bone Marrow Transplant (BMT)
For high-risk, relapsed, or treatment-resistant leukemia, bone marrow transplantation may offer the best chance of cure.

Success Rates and Hope
Many children with Acute Lymphoblastic Leukemia (ALL) achieve cure rates exceeding 80–90%, depending on the disease subtype and treatment response. Outcomes continue to improve due to advances in risk stratification, supportive care, and transplantation.
Early diagnosis and treatment by an experienced pediatric hematologist-oncologist play a critical role in maximizing the chance of cure.
